Output 91afda1f941aa12e1b3a66544bc084e969598d4f387d7d76ead68e952e49aefb:103

value
2693084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c024841017931a873b458f647268fb751f2a3223 OP_EQUAL
address
3KCyQYQkVQ5i7L1tZJoFn12Kqk5dESrS5G
transaction
91afda1f941aa12e1b3a66544bc084e969598d4f387d7d76ead68e952e49aefb
spent
true